> Removed useless fb-chroma option.
> 
> It could not work.

Why couldn't it work ?

It's useful on TI Davinci dm6446 device which has 4 different
framebuffers with different image formats (2 * UYVY, 1 * RV16, 1 custom)

There's no way to know the image format from the linux fb API, so you
have to specify it (with --fb-chroma)
